ALEXANDRIA, Va., Sept. 23 -- United States Patent no. 12,423,478, issued on Sept. 23, was assigned to Dell Products LP (Round Rock, Texas).
"Validation of component transfers between information handling systems" was invented by A Anis Ahmed (Bangalore, India), Jason Matthew Young (Round Rock, Texas) and Balakrishna Padhy (Bangalore, India).
According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"Systems and methods are provided for validation of the transfer of hardware components between two different IHSs (Information Handling Systems).
